Changed defaults in Splitfork, our assignment service. Bucketing now uses sticky hashing per account instead of per session, and the holdout slice grew from 2% to 5%. Callers relying on session-level reassignment must opt in explicitly. Review the diff against the new baseline; the updated default configuration is listed below.

config for tagep-kajof:
[casir]
port = 6379
region = south-1
host = casir.paliqdyn.example
team = tamax
timeout_ms = 250
retries = 2

Heads up: if your plugin keeps dropping off the Wavelet socket every ~90 seconds, that's the reconnect bug in gateway 2.4, not your code. The workaround until 2.5 lands is to force sticky sessions through the relay, which means your plugin authenticates directly instead of piggybacking on the gateway. Set up a local .env for your plugin and put this line in it first.

vault entry, yahif-yajep: COURIER_KEY29=b802bdf8034096b65a51c6ba5abe2

New Subscription Tier: "Keystone" (Managers Only)

Quick rundown for sales leads: we're launching the Keystone tier of the Fernway platform next quarter. It sits between Standard and Summit, bundling advanced reporting and priority onboarding at roughly 1.6x the Standard price. Early pilots with Hollybrook Partners went well — churn risk looks low. Don't pitch it externally yet; collateral lands in two weeks. Pricing rationale ties into the confidential plans noted just below.

internal memo for hahif-hahaf: Headcount on the Zorwyn team goes from 9 to 100 by the end of October. Gross margin on Zorwyn came in at 5 percent against a plan of 10 percent.